Ok. I've delved into reality, it's time for a return to my preferred subject matter.

A few weeks before my trip to the Philippines, I caught up with Bianca for an outdoor shoot. (If anyone cares to recall, it was a few hours after I took this shot, and same location!

This was nothing sophisticated. No reflectors, no flash, just kit lenses and winter sunlight (if this was higher resolution you'd see her goosebumps!)

My aim here was to experiment with the rim-light effect of the sun. No crop or PP besides contrast +5, resize and sharpen. Fortunately for me, Bianca can make any photograph look ok.

Nice to see you're back to your specialty, and nice to see Bianca again. I think that model, setting and light are excellent and the portrait is certainly very good, but I find that you could have combined these elements even better. To put it in different way, the visual impact of this image is not as high as it could be and you took even better portraits of Bianca in the past. I agree with the others that the crop should have been tighter but I have the feeling that the light is the main problem here. The highlights in the hair are nice, but the face of the model and most of the picture in fact don't receive much light and consequently do not stand out enough. That's just a feeling and I do not have the experience to back this up. I wonder if a reflector would have made the difference between very good and outstanding.
